Types of Internet Connections Available in Littleton

When it comes to selecting an internet provider in Littleton, understanding the different types of internet connections available is essential. Here are the primary types of connections you’ll encounter:

Fiber Optic Internet

Fiber optic internet offers ultra-fast speeds and is considered the best option for high-demand households and businesses. Fiber optic networks transmit data using light signals, resulting in faster speeds and higher reliability compared to other types of internet. If you need fast internet for activities like gaming, streaming, or working from home, fiber optic may be the best choice.

Cable Internet

Cable internet is another high-speed option that is widely available in Littleton. It uses the same coaxial cables as cable TV, delivering internet with speeds that are suitable for most households. While not as fast as fiber optics, cable internet offers a good balance between speed and price.

DSL Internet

DSL (Digital Subscriber Line) is an older, but still widely available, internet connection type. DSL uses existing telephone lines, offering lower speeds than fiber or cable but is often the most affordable option for those on a budget. If high-speed internet isn’t a priority, DSL can provide a decent and cost-effective choice.

Satellite Internet

For those living in rural or remote areas of Littleton, satellite internet might be the only viable option. Although satellite internet has improved in recent years, it still tends to be slower and less reliable than other types. It’s also more expensive, but it can be a lifesaver if there are no other options available.

Fixed Wireless Internet

Fixed wireless internet uses radio signals to deliver internet to specific areas. It’s not as widely available as other types of internet connections, but it can be an excellent alternative for people living in areas with limited infrastructure.

Key Factors to Consider When Choosing an Internet Provider

Before committing to an internet provider, there are several factors to take into account to ensure you choose the best one for your needs.

Internet Speed

Consider the speed that you need based on how you use the internet. Streaming videos, playing online games, or running a home business requires faster speeds, while browsing the web or checking email may not need as much bandwidth.

Cost

While some providers offer competitive pricing, it’s important to consider both the base price and any hidden fees. Promotions might lure you in with low introductory rates, but make sure you check the long-term pricing before making a decision.

Contract Terms

Some internet providers require a contract that locks you in for a certain peperiodOthers offer more flexibility with no-contract plans. Make sure to understand the terms, including installation fees and cancellation charges, before you commit.

Customer Service

Look for providers that offer excellent customer service, as you’ll want support if issues arise. Reading customer reviews and testimonials can provide insight into how well a company handles troubleshooting and service problems.

Availability

Internet service availability can vary depending on where you live in Littleton. Be sure to check if your desired provider offers service at your specific address, especially if you live in a more remote part of town.
